(AP) - Scientists at the Savannah River Ecology Lab in South Carolina want to know, can Burmese pythons that have been spreading north in Florida survive in places like the Carolinas, or Tennessee? So they've dumped seven of them into a pit surrounded by 400 feet of reinforced fence at … WebThe Burmese python is the largest subspecies of the Indian python and one of the six largest snakes in the world. Lengths of over 15 feet (4.6 meters) are common, and they may exceed 22 feet (6.7 meters) in human care, however the average is about 16 feet (4.9 meters) in length. WebNov 18, 2024 · One female python can lay 50-100 eggs in a single year. While winter has kept them mostly contained, some snakes are finding animal burrows that help them survive cold weather. This gives them the potential to move further north if they can find enough burrows.
